Merthyr Mawr Village Conservation Area
Merthyr Mawr Village is a mid-sized conservation area in Wales, covering approximately 20.6 hectares of protected landscape. It is designated in 1973 during the initial wave of conservation area protection, reflecting the area's longstanding cultural and architectural significance.
At 20.6 hectares, this is a compact conservation area — smaller than the UK average of around 45 hectares.

- What restrictions apply in Merthyr Mawr Village?
- Properties in Merthyr Mawr Village Conservation Area may face restrictions on demolition, tree work (6 weeks' notice required), and certain exterior alterations. Contact your local planning authority for specific rules that apply here.
